Oligonucleotide Synthesis Market size was valued at USD 7.8 billion in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 9.21 billion in 2024 to USD 34.86 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 18.1% during the forecast period (2025-2032).
Rapidly increasing prevalence of chronic diseases around the world and high investments in medical R&D are projected to primarily propel the demand for oligonucleotide synthesis. The growing popularity of precision and personalized medicine is also expected to generate new business for oligonucleotide synthesis providers in the future. Increasing acceptance of gene therapies for the treatment of various indications and expanding application scope for oligonucleotides in multiple healthcare verticals will also create new opportunities for oligonucleotide synthesis companies. Moreover, advancements in synthesis technologies and the rising use of nucleic acid-based therapeutics are also anticipated to drive oligonucleotide synthesis market growth potential over the coming years. Robust spending on healthcare research in the North American region allows it to become the dominant market for oligonucleotide synthesis companies around the world. On the contrary, high costs of synthesis, complex regulatory framework, ethical concerns regarding gene therapies, and limited manufacturing capacity are some major constraints that slow down oligonucleotide synthesis demand.

PCR primers are projected to account for a prominent chunk of the global oligonucleotide synthesis market share. Surging investments in genetic research and growing use of PCR primers in the same is also expected to help the dominance of this segment. Advancements in PCR technology is also expected to create new opportunities for oligonucleotide synthesis companies operating in this segment. The crucial role of PCR primers in accurate gene quantification will also contribute to the dominance of this segment.
On the other hand, the demand for oligonucleotide synthesis for sequencing applications is projected to surge at a notable pace over the coming years. Rapidly increasing demand for RNA and DNA sequencing owing to rising popularity of gene therapies and advancements in sequencing technologies are projected to help this segment bolster oligonucleotide synthesis market growth in the future.
P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ies are slated to account for the highest demand for oligonucleotide synthesis around the world. Growing investments in R&D and rising demand for novel drugs and therapeutics are helping p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ies spearhead oligonucleotide synthesis demand outlook on a global level. Efficient drug administration through the use of oligonucleotides will also be a factor helping the dominance of this segment.
Meanwhile, the demand for oligonucleotide synthesis in academic research institutes is estimated to rise rapidly across the study period. Growing number of academic research institutes and supportive government initiatives and funding to promote advancements in oligonucleotide synthesis are helping this segment generate new opportunities for oligonucleotide synthesis companies. Increasing the number of collaborations between academic research institutions and pharmaceutical companies will also help this segment bring in major revenue going forward.

North America is projected to account for a dominant oligonucleotide synthesis market share. The presence of a strong medical research infrastructure, supportive government funding for research, and rising use of genetic treatments are helping this region maintain its high market share. The United States and Canada are estimated to be the leading markets in this region as incidence of chronic diseases rises in these countries. The presence of leading p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ies will also promote the demand for oligonucleotide synthesis in this region.
The surging prevalence demand for precision medicine in the Asia Pacific region makes it the fastest-growing market for oligonucleotide synthesis companies in the world. Increasing investments in genetic research and rising awareness regarding the benefits of gene therapies and therapeutics are expected to bolster oligonucleotide synthesis market growth in this region. Increasing geriatric population and rising healthcare expenditure will also create new opportunities for oligonucleotide synthesis companies in the Asia Pacific region. Japan, China, and India will be the leading markets for oligonucleotide synthesis providers in this region.

Oligonucleotides play a key role in diagnostic tools such as PCR, qPCR, and next-generation sequencing (NGS) and demand for early diagnostics is increasing rapidly. This factor is projected to create new opportunities for oligonucleotide synthesis market growth going forward.
Use of AI and Automation: Automation and artificial intelligence are being integrated into oligonucleotide synthesis processes, to enhance the accuracy and scalability of the process. Automated synthesizers and AI-driven design tools are projected to be highly popular as they can assist in cost reduction as well.
